Excel如何有效提取省市区信息

在数据处理中,许多用户需要从完整的地址中提取省、市和区的信息。在使用Excel时,这一过程可以通过多种方法实现。本文将详细介绍如何在Excel中提取省市区,帮助你更高效地处理地址数据。

1. 提取省市区的必要性

在许多商业和社会活动中,准确的地理信息至关重要。尤其是在电商、物流、市场调研等领域,获取用户的省市区信息能够帮助企业进行精准营销、资源优化配置等。

2. 地址格式的常见类型

在开始提取操作之前,首先了解常见的地址格式将有助于准确提取。
以下是几种常见地址格式示例:

  • 省、市、区:如“广东省深圳市南山区”
  • 省、市:如“江苏省南京市”
  • :如“北京市”
  • 省、市、县:如“浙江省绍兴市越城区”

3. Excel中的文本函数

在Excel中,有几个文本函数可以帮助提取省市区信息,主要包括:

  • LEFT:返回文本左侧指定数量的字符
  • RIGHT:返回文本右侧指定数量的字符
  • MID:返回文本中间指定位置的字符
  • FIND:查找文本中某个字符的位置
  • LEN:返回文本的字符长度

4. 使用公式提取省市区

4.1 提取省

假设地址在A2单元格中,使用下列公式来提取省:
excel
=LEFT(A2, FIND(“省”, A2)+1)

说明:该公式使用FIND函数找到“省”的位置,然后利用LEFT函数截取省名。

4.2 提取市

提取市的公式如下:
excel
=MID(A2, FIND(“省”, A2)+1, FIND(“市”, A2)-FIND(“省”, A2))

说明:该公式结合MID函数和FIND函数,定位市的字符串位置,进行提取。

4.3 提取区

提取区的公式如下:
excel
=MID(A2, FIND(“市”, A2)+1, FIND(“区”, A2)-FIND(“市”, A2))

说明:根据市和区的位置,使用MID函数提取相应数据。

5. 使用Excel的分列功能

除了使用函数外,Excel还提供了分列功能,可以通过以下步骤快速提取数据:

  1. 选中地址所在的列
  2. 转到“数据”选项卡,选择“文本到列”
  3. 选择分隔符(如空格或逗号)进行拆分
  4. 根据拆分结果进行数据校对

6. 如何处理复杂地址

有些地址可能比较复杂,可能需要手动检查已提取的省市区,确保其准确性。可以使用条件格式及查找功能,帮助验证提取结果。

7. 常见问题解答

7.1 如何处理没有省市区的地址?

  • 对于缺省地址,可以考虑使用VLOOKUP函数或IF函数进行判断,并返回相应的默认值。

7.2 提取的省市区不准确,怎么办?

  • 检查地址格式是否一致。确保所有地址遵循相同的格式,可以使用数据验证功能进行限制。

7.3 有没有自动化工具提取省市区?

  • 可以考虑使用VBA编程来实现更复杂的提取功能,特别是在处理大量数据时。

7.4 如何避免提取空值?

  • 在使用公式时,可结合IF与ISBLANK函数,先判断地址单元格是否为空,避免空值提取问题。

8. 结论

提取省市区信息在数据处理过程中是一个常见而又重要的任务。掌握Excel中的文本函数和相应的数据处理技巧,可以大大提高工作效率。希望本文的介绍能够帮助你在日常工作中,更加便利地获取所需的地理信息。

正文完
 0